The Wien2k userguide for case.in7(c) has format(A3,1X,A3,1X,A5) for
the switch iunit whpsi line.
If you have
ABS ANG LARGE
The first A3 reads ABS (three places). The second format input 1X reads
the one blank space (one place) between ABS and ANG.
For
RE ANG LARGE
The A3 needs to read RE
